RESPONSIBILITIES
• Applies Good Manufacturing Principles in all areas of responsibility.
• Demonstrates and promotes the company vision.
• Programming of computer numerically controlled production equipment. This programming will include items such as form, fill & seal tooling, sealing boards, filling templates, loading rings, etc.
• Set up and operate our CNC vertical milling machine, CNC router as well as other machine shop equipment and hand tools necessary to manufacture components.
• Perform in-process inspection and documentation of all manufactured components.
• Coordinate projects or portions of projects efficiently and effectively between Tooling and the other groups in the Technical Services Department. This includes all changes that affect packaging, tooling, materials, equipment and efficiency ratings.
• Maintains CNC shop tools and equipment including CNC vertical milling machine, CNC router and related components.
• Implement, maintain and properly utilize all Tooling related documentation and databases.

• On call at managements request to assist in meeting customer project deadlines. Knowledge, Skills, Abilities Education: High School Diploma OR GED Required Experience:
• Minimum 2+ years experience using MasterCAM to create parts and generate CNC programs
• Experience operating a CNC vertical machining center
• Experience with AutoCAD computer software
• Experience with SolidWorks computer software
• Experience with Microsoft office products (including but not limited to Word, Excel, PowerPoint, MS Project, Outlook, and Microsoft Windows)
• The ability to read, write, and complete basic mathematical calculations with a calculator
• Good customer service skills
• A good mechanical aptitude
• The ability to work with minimum supervision
• Above average responsibility
• The ability to schedule multiple and varied projects to meet deadlines
• Mastery of skills required to read, understand, and adhere to the SOPs and policies of a GMP environment. Physical Requirements
• Physical ability to lift up to 50 pounds
